Nitrogen uptake conditions at VERTIGO study sites M Elskens, N Brion, F Dehairs, W Baeyens & N Savoye Pleinlaan 2, B-1050 Brussel , Belgium ([email protected]) Introduction Nitrogen uptake conditions were surveyed in the photic zone at station Aloha 22°45N-158°W during 2004 VERTIGO Hawaii cruise and at station K2 47°N-161°E during 2005 VERTIGO Northwest Pacific cruise using stable isotope techniques. We aimed at determining new production rates, and therefore 15N and 13C isotopically labelled compounds were used in a series of tracer experiments conducted over a 3 week period at the VERTIGO sites. Experimental design 1.At station Aloha, combined 15N (NO3, NO2, NH4, N2) and 13C tracer experiments were conducted over periods of 12 hours under constant illumination and neutral density screens to mimic in situ light attenuation. Sampling depths were 5, 25, 50 & 125m. 2.At station K2, 15N (NO3, NH4) and 13C tracer experiments were conducted over periods of 2, 4 and 6 hours under constant illumination and neutral density screens to mimic in situ light attenuation. Sampling depths were 5, 25, 40 & 50m. The authors would like to thank Ken Buesseler for the scientific coordination of the VERTIGO project Two regimes of new production have been identified; K2 shows relatively high nitrate specific uptake rates (VNO3) but rather low new production rates and is characteristic of HNLC regions. Aloha has low VNO3, low new production and behaves typically as an oligotrophic area. At both sites there is an agreement between the estimates of new production and the POC flux samples by neutrally buoyant traps at 150m with an export ratio ranging from 1 (Aloha) to maximally 3 at K2.
